About the Role:
The Charge Nurse plays a critical role in ensuring the delivery of high-quality patient care in a healthcare setting. This position involves overseeing nursing staff, coordinating patient care activities, and ensuring compliance with healthcare regulations and standards. The Charge Nurse will be responsible for assessing patient needs, developing care plans, and implementing nursing interventions. Additionally, this role requires effective communication with patients, families, and interdisciplinary teams to promote optimal health outcomes. Ultimately, the Charge Nurse is pivotal in fostering a safe and supportive environment for both patients and staff.

Skills:
The required skills for this position include strong clinical assessment abilities, which are essential for evaluating patient conditions and determining appropriate interventions. Leadership skills are crucial as the Charge Nurse will guide and mentor nursing staff, fostering a collaborative team environment. Effective communication skills are necessary for interacting with patients, families, and healthcare professionals, ensuring that everyone is informed and engaged in the care process. Time management skills are vital for prioritizing tasks and managing multiple patient care responsibilities efficiently. Additionally, problem-solving skills will be utilized to address any challenges that arise in patient care, ensuring that high standards are maintained.
